It appears the LEGO Harry Potter Collection coming to Nintendo Switch could be more than a rumour, with an official rating for the game now surfacing via the Game Software Rating Regulations body in Taiwan.

This follows the Argos catalogue listing the game's arrival on Switch this November for £24.99. The remastered compilation was originally released exclusively on the PlayStation 4 in 2016 by Traveller's Tales and brings together LEGO Harry Potter: Years 1-4 and LEGO Harry Potter: Years 5-7. The collection also includes character and spell DLC packs.
